Output 3b84c60647e8e7468ea17a8d527fe584414eef1df78e1bc1f80aff1c87888992:1

value
633000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74d50319274d532e3a9fe47e1890d5fa34903f2b OP_EQUAL
address
3CLmV8sDwYs1VYaqaYmZsy4QDp6ahLJNea
transaction
3b84c60647e8e7468ea17a8d527fe584414eef1df78e1bc1f80aff1c87888992
spent
true